Ibm db2 universal jdbc type 4 driver for ibm db2 database

Ibm db2 universal jdbc type 4 driver for ibm db2 database see setting up the jdbc driver. If you use the db2 universal driver type 4 for access to db2 network server, and your database fails, the database server issues a generic 99999 exception in response to every jdbc getconnection request. Jdbc driver for ibm db2 universal 807581 feb 22, 2005 7. The java tm application first loads the jdbc driver by invoking the class. When the sqljjdbc profile is customized in the following step, it writes four database. Ibms fix pack site has the ibm data server driver for jdbc and sqlj which is nothing but the jdbc type 4 driver. Ibm db2 jdbc driver for realtime sql access datadirect. Db2 database connection jdbc and odbc connection help for. Googling for db2 type 4 driver gives me this page of ibm. This bridge establishes a jdbc connection to a db2 database server in order to extract the physical metadata. Create a suitable operating system user to access the table functions used in ibm db2. I wonder if anyone has compared the db2 universal jdbc driver type 2. Razorsql ships with the ibm db2 universal type 4 jdbc driver.

Ibm zos application connectivity to db2 for zos and os390. The jdbc driver is available from ibm, and consists of the following files that the agent must be able to access. If you install this version of the driver, you must configure a db2 universal jdbc driver provider xa to access remote db2 databases. Ibm db2 universal jdbc type 4 driver for ibm db2 database see setting up the jdbc driver ibm db2 universal database create a suitable operating system user to access the table functions used in ibm db2. This apar provides a new, alternate delivery of the ibm db2 driver for jdbc and sqlj. To use the app driver, the db2 client software should be installed on your machine. Im testing the iib developer edition on windows 10. If you can point me in the right direction, i would greatly appreciate it. The jdbc driver is used to connect a javabased application to an ibm db2 database that is running on either the same machine or a remote machine. Our scenarios use the jdbc driver for type4 access from windows to a remote dli database and db2 tables and extend it to use ibm mashup center to provide an effective web interface and to integrate with open database. This alternate delivery of the ibm db2 driver for jdbc and sqlj is being provided with db2 for zos version 8 in order to provide the availability of significant new features and functional enhancements over the existing drivers provided in db2 for zos version 8. If you use a different driver, querysurge supports you via the connection wizards connection extensibility feature. Server driver for jdbc and sqlj type 4 connectivity to connect to a db2 for ibm. The meanings of the initial portion of the url are.

Has anyone have had an opportunity to configure the connection pool using ibm db2 universal jdbc, specifically the type 4. Set and validate the preferred credentials on all agents where you want to deploy the plugin. The port for your db2 database 50000 is the default port the db2 database name. I cant really speak for what ibm supports in this regard but we datadirect support multiple version of the database from one version of the driver. Connecting to a data source using the drivermanager. Ibm s fix pack site has the ibm data server driver for jdbc and sqlj which is nothing but the jdbc type 4 driver. Steps for db2 jdbc datasource configuration in websphere. Our jdbc driver can be easily used with all versions of sql and across both 32bit and 64bit platforms. Typical jdbc type 4 connection definitions to db2 for zos. This version provides both driver type 2 and driver type 4 support.

Db2 11 java url format for ibm data server driver for. For ibm data server driver for jdbc and sqlj type 4 connectivity, the. The jta support in the type 4 connectivity of the universal jdbc driver enables db2 jdbc applications to participate in twophase commit transactions that conforms to the xaopen specification, which along with connection pooling is required by many missioncritical enterprise applications. The db2 universal jdbc driver in db2 udb for zos version 8. How to create a jdbc connection jdbc data source from integration node to db2 cfdb database duration. Understand the db2 udb jdbc universal driver ibm developer.

Ibm db2 database plugin overview and prerequisites oracle docs. Db2 datasource configuration installation oskar idashboards. Because the weblogic type 4 jdbc db2 driver automatically creates a db2 package if one does not already exist, running this utility creates a default db2 package on the db2 server. The db2 universal jdbc driver for db2 udb for os390 and zos version 7, as documented in apar pq80841. Select the database type as db2 and select the provider type as db2 universal jdbc driver provider and select the implementation type as connection pool data source as shown in the above screen. Installing the ibm data server driver for jdbc and sqlj on db2 for. Understand the db2 udb jdbc universal driver from 2005. Can one specify a default schema as part of the url. Enterprise manager system monitoring plugin installation. Db2 on linux, unix, and windows systems supports the following driver. The following indicates that a type 2 or type 4 driver is being used.

Url format for ibm data server driver for jdbc and sqlj. With the federated functionality that is built into db2 universal database, intelligent miner operations can access db2 data directly, as well as a variety of other data sources supported by db2. The jdbc driver that ibm db2 product installs is called the ibm db2 runtime client. In a clustered deployment of tivoli identity manager, the jdbc driver enables all the tivoli identity manager servers to communicate with the data source and share information. If you are curious to see how we handle it, we have a support matrix, that shows what versions of the database our current jdbc driver supports. Db2 udb v4r5, v5r1, and v5r2 running on iseries and as400. A brand new type 4 jdbc driver built with the new architecture. Does jdbc driver need to be upgraded when updating. The application does not work with the universal driver type 4 add db2jcc. With ibm zos application connectivity to db2 for zos bottom part of the figure above, you no longer need a local db2 db2a on the same machine as your a websphere application server. For more information, see the ibm universal jdbc driver documentation. Ibm data server driver and db2 12 for zos for jdbc type 4.

The db2 universal jdbc driver with the feature zos application connectivity to db2 for zos, which provides type 4 connectivity only. Now you have to select type of jdbc provider to create. Using the db2 universal jdbc driver to access db2 for zos ibm. Sql developer will not only help you to connect to db2 database engine but also. The type 2 driver allows connecting through the local db2 instance using the information that is cataloged about the remote database. For type 4 jdbc driver support from a client machine where db2 is not installed. In a type 2 mode, the universal jdbc driver provides local application performance gains because it avoids using tcpip protocol to communicate to the db2 server. Because the weblogic type 4 jdbc db2 driver automatically creates a db2 package if one does not already exist. Ive configured my websphere portal server to use type 4. Db2 for i is a member of ibm s family of db2 databases. Connecting to a data source using the drivermanager interface. Progress datadirects jdbc driver for ibm db2 offers a highperforming, secure and reliable connectivity solution for jdbc applications to access ibm db2 data. The way you tell whether you are using the type 2 or type 4 driver is from the form of the connection. This driver does not need further licensing for db2 database systems that is, the.

This is because the nonuniversal jdbc driver for zos and os390 is a type 2 driver and cannot directly access a remote db2 system db2b. When an application loads the db2 universal jdbc driver, a single driver instance is loaded for type 2 and type 4 implementations. Severe problem using jdbc preparedstatement with ibm db2. Difference between ibm db2 jdbc driver files db2jcc. To ensure that database connections are correctly released on intel platforms, use. What makes db2 for i unique is its integration with the platform, the ibm i operating system and power systems. According to the jdbc specification, there are four types of jdbc driver. Ibm db2 universal jdbc type 4 driver for ibm db2 database see setting up the jdbc driver ibm db2 universal database. Cannot find db2 driver when creating a new db connection. Ive configured my websphere portal server to use type 4 db2. The available versions of the db2 universal jdbc driver to connect with db2 on zos are as follows.

For many years i have seen a proliferation of java applications of all sorts connecting and processing data on db2 for zos. Universal db resource adapter universal jdbc driver universal dli driver. The ibm data server driver for jdbc and sqlj package includes two jdbc drivers. You may obtain the above driver files from site or they can be. For this reason, if you use type 4 connectivity to access a remote db2 on. Jdbc drivers hooking up with ibm db2 universal database. Ibm db2 requires a type 2 java database connectivity driver jdbc driver as the database client. Indicates that the connection is to a db2 for zos, db2 on linux, unix, and windows systems. Querysurge db2 builtin support is for the ibm jcc universal driver. Db2 universal jdbc driver type 2 and type 4 the db2 universal jdbc driver is a single driver that includes jdbc type 2 and jdbc type 4 behavior, as well as sqlj support. Intelligent miner models stored in db2 databases inherent in all the administrative and processing advantages. We also test with the jdbc drivers for db2 luw listed on this page.

Type 4 driver support uses a communication protocol to communicate requests from a zos application to a remote db2 database. Ibm fss fci and counter fraud management 4,837 views 7. Jdbc type 4 universal driver sql error code 99999 db2. Ibm db2 universal database for linux, unix and windows, v8. This usually entails installing the ibm db2 client software. Severe problem using jdbc preparedstatement with ibm db2 universal jdbc driver as type 4.

As of this time, i strongly recommend the latest available driver db2 v11. With a type 4 driver you would directly connect to the remote db2 database. Listed below are connection examples for three common jdbc drivers for ibm db2. Db2 whm v8 customers can order a media pack that contains db2 query patroller v7. This unique integration means you do less managing of your database, and more building of applications for analytics, mobile, cloud, or day to day operational purposes. The db2 universal jdbc driver provider by apar pq80841 on db2 udb for os390 and zos version 7. Jdbc driver for ibm db2 universal oracle community. This tutorial is about connecting to db2 database using oracle sql developer client and third party jdbc driver. The universal driver the ibm db2 universal driver is a type 4 jdbc driver. The name of the file that contains the db2 app driver is usually db2java. Supported drivers for jdbc and sqlj ibm knowledge center.

Some application servers do not allow sending a default sql command upon connection, so i cant rely on set schema xyz, hence the need to set the default via the jdbc url. Connecting to a data source using the drivermanager interface with the db2 universal jdbc driver. The jdbc driver gives out the connection to the database and implements the protocol. Database failure triggers problematic 99999 exception for applications that use db2 universal driver type 4. Information about the jdbc driver for ibm db2 is available online. Though the page i pointed to above happens to be the windows page, its the same type 4 driver for all platforms, as should be expected. Ibm data server driver for jdbc and sqlj type 4 connectivity url option descriptions.

Both of them are db2 jdbc driver jar files and are type 4 drivers. Configure squirrel sql to connect to ibm db2 squirrel sql is a great light weight generic sql client that i have started using for more than 7 years now. The bea weblogic type 4 jdbc driver for db2 the db2 driver supports. Dec 23, 2005 the way you tell whether you are using the type 2 or type 4 driver is from the form of the connection. At a quick glance, it is a bit difficult to see the difference between the syntax of listing 2 showing the use of the universal driver as jdbc type 2 driver and listing 3 showing the use of the universal driver as a jdbc type 4 driver. The universal driver the ibm db2 universal driver is a type4 jdbc driver. Ibm zos application connectivity to db2 for zos and os. Does jdbc driver need to be upgraded when updating database.

Any jvms that run java applications that access db2 databases must include. Order title number ibm db2 universal database sc094839 master index ibm db2 universal database. The db2 universal jdbc driver is an architectureneutral jdbc driver for. It is critical that the parameters are filled correctly in order to satisfy the local connection requirements on. A jdbc application can establish a connection to a data source using the jdbc drivermanager interface, which is part of the java. Ibm db2 jdbc connection to cataloged database via ssl. For more information, see configure the management agent to deploy the plugin. To create a package on the db2 server with the weblogic type 4 jdbc db2 driver, you can use the weblogic server dbping utility. Configure the driver and database for interoperability.

This driver should work properly for most installations of db2 udb for linux, unix, and windows. Ibm has announced no new features will be added to the legacy drivers. The dbping utility is used to test the connection between your client machine and a dbms via a jdbc driver. Add it to the driver properties list for the actual database connection. Connecting to db2 database using sql developer and jdbc. I have installed websphere portal and db2 on my system, but am getting various db errors, such as this. Samploc samploc is the name of the local database alias.

740 49 993 464 1281 202 865 1294 472 299 761 1500 909 484 566 362 571 507 139 1267 1341 716 1374 1222 389 1310 795 1127 434 307 795